Job Summary
You will play a key role in advancing the PKCS#11‑based cryptographic abstraction layer for NVIDIA DriveOS across QNX, Linux, and safety/RTOS environments.
This role balances around 50/50 between providing technical guidance and Scrum/delivery ownership, including sprint planning, backlog management, and tracking progress toward milestones.
You will build a culture of technical excellence, ownership, and collaboration by championing sound engineering practices, thoughtful code reviews, and knowledge sharing.
